Premier Soccer League SuperSport United to play their remaining PSL games at Bidvest Stadium

Bidvest Stadium

Premier Soccer League side SuperSport United announce on Wednesday that they will play the remainder of the season at Bidvest Stadium.

South African top-flight will resume on August 8 as revealed by PSL chairman Irvin Khoza on Monday. However, Pretoria giants will no more play at Lucas Moripe Stadium for at least this season as they announce new stadium.

“Our new home for the remainder of the ABSA Premiership season will be Bidvest Stadium” the club announce on social media.

As a reminder, SSU were 3rd on ABSA Premiership table before league suspension in March due to Covid-19. They have 40 points in 24 games played with one game more than the fourth based-club Orlando Pirates with the same total.

SuperSport United played won their last game to 2-0 against Highlands Park on March 8.
